QWhat can you do with the epidermis part of your skin?

  • A Regulate body temperature
  • B Store excess fat
  • C Produce sweat
  • D Sense touch
Correct Answer

Explanation

The epidermis contains sensory receptors that help us detect pressure, temperature, and pain.
Incorrect answer options:
A) Regulate body temperature
Explanation: The regulation of body temperature is primarily the function of the sweat glands and blood vessels in the dermis layer of the skin, not the epidermis.
B) Store excess fat
The storage of excess fat is primarily the function of the subcutaneous layer of the skin, not the epidermis.
